Why Resolving Financial Health Is Secret to Labor Force Stability
The American Psychological Organization (APA) has consistently reported that economic issues are one of the leading resources of stress and anxiety for grownups in the united state Over 70% of participants in a current APA study specified that cash worries are a considerable stress factor in their lives. This anxiety has direct implications for workplace efficiency: staff members distracted by individual monetary concerns are more likely to experience fatigue, miss due dates, and choose new task chances with greater wages to cover their debts.
Financially stressed out workers are additionally extra susceptible to health and wellness concerns, such as anxiety, clinical depression, and high blood pressure, which contribute to increased healthcare expenses for companies. Resolving this issue early, with thorough financial obligation resolution services, can mitigate these threats and foster a healthier, more stable labor force.
